Abstract

The quality of irrigation with wide-coverage sprinkler equipment largely depends on the design of sprinklers and their location on the rain belt. The purpose of the presented article is to improve the methodology for calculating sprinklers and to develop recommendations on the applicability of sprinklers in various conditions. The article presents a method for determining the nozzle diameter based on ensuring uniformity of irrigation, characteristics of the water flow coming off the deflector, and the radius of capture by rain. The trajectories of movement in the opposite direction of the wind for droplets with different sizes are given. The optimal angle is indicated depending on the wind speed. The maximum radius corresponds to the angle of departure of the water flow to the horizon within 28..32 °. The distance between the sprinklers along the water supply pipeline of wide-reach sprinklers should be at least 2/3 of the radius of rain capture, without taking into account the effects of wind.
